Where to dispose of motor oil for free

EPA considers some leftover household products that can catch fire, react, or explode under certain circumstances, or that are corrosive or toxic as household hazardous waste. Products, such as paints, cleaners, oils, batteries, and pesticides can contain hazardous ingredients and require special care when you dispose of them.

Where to dispose of motor oil for free. The amount of used motor oil disposed of improperly by Do-it-yourselfer auto mechanics every eighteen (18) days is approximately 11 million gallons. One gallon of used motor oil that is re-refined will produce 2.5 quarts of lubricating oil, but it takes 42 gallons of crude oil to produce the same 2.5 quarts of lubricating oil.

Keep your used motor oil in a clean, leakproof container like a plastic jug or bottle. Make sure the cap is tightly sealed and store in a cool, dry place away from heat, sunlight, children and pets. Used motor oil can't be recycled if it's mixed with other liquids like antifreeze or brake fluid. By recycling your used motor oil, you can keep the environment safe, and save resources. Used motor oil can be re-refined into motor oil that’s as good as new, or reprocessed as industrial boiler fuel. E-waste: Computers, computer monitors, printers, cell phones, telephones, televisions, and radios are household hazardous waste.What Happens to Recycled Motor Oil. Used motor oil can be cleaned and recycled, which helps keep it out of waterways. Recycled oil is then used to make heating oil, asphalt and other petroleum-based products. Recycling used motor oil not only keeps our environment clean, it also limits the need for the additional production of new oil, thus preserving natural resources.Motor oil should be free of contaminants (gasoline, antifreeze, paint thinner, solvents, dirt, leaves, water, etc.) and placed in a clean, container with a tight-fitting cap (such as a one-gallon plastic milk jug) before recycling. Used motor oil bottles and other plastic containers that hold motor oil should be thrown away. They cannot be ...Recycling oil is cheaper than refining oil from crude. It takes 42 gallons of crude oil but only 1 gallon of used motor oil to produce the same 2.5 quarts of lubricating oil. Recycling oil also reduces our independence on foreign oil; the more oil we recycle, the less oil we need to purchase from other sources.Aug 3, 2023 · One gallon of used motor oil provides the same 2.5 quarts of lubricating oil as 42 gallons of crude oil. How it Works: Recycling Used Oil and Oil Filters Used oil can be re-refined into lubricants, processed into fuel oils, and used as raw materials for the refining and petrochemical industries.
